Output 8e916d8ba62af6ec665bbd1265acd308f6f16867d4d4be5b50547f9c914fb07a:13

value
759516070
script pubkey
OP_0 OP_PUSHBYTES_20 2d08408351deb0952e7c87bc8669a2eccfba3aaf
address
ltc1q95yypq63m6cf2tnus77gv6dzan8m5w40ludk8y
transaction
8e916d8ba62af6ec665bbd1265acd308f6f16867d4d4be5b50547f9c914fb07a
spent
true